About Body Drop 3D

Body Drop 3D centers on the interaction between physics and the environment. Players use mouse-driven controls to interact with balls and other objects to achieve specific outcomes within a three-dimensional space. The game emphasizes the impact of momentum and gravity, tasking you with clearing levels through calculated movements. It fits into the action-physics subgenre where precision and timing are essential to progressing through the various challenges.

The appeal lies in the visual feedback of the physics engine and the challenge of navigating 3D obstacles. It suits players who enjoy experimental gameplay where trial and error lead to mastery over the mechanics. Because of its specific themes and focus on physical impact, it is geared toward a more mature audience looking for focused, physics-driven entertainment.

How to play

Use your mouse to interact with the environment and manipulate objects. The primary objective involves using physics-based balls to eliminate targets within each level. Carefully aim your movements to trigger chain reactions or direct hits. Success depends on understanding how objects react to force and gravity. Observe the layout of each stage before acting to find the most efficient way to clear the area.

Tips for beginners

  • Focus on the momentum of the balls to maximize the force of each impact.
  • Look for structural weaknesses in the environment to clear targets more effectively.
  • Use small, precise mouse movements for better control over the physics-based objects.
